Hi, verifier error which isn't fatal in jboss3.0 but is in jboss3.2.1. >15:02:12,109 WARN [verifier] EJB spec violation: >Bean : GangsterEJB >Section: 10.6.2 >Warning: CMP entity beans may not define the implementation of a finder. > Is there any way around this as it's part of the Crime portal example and I > don't know enough about it to go hacking away at it. You can try to disable the strict verifier in jboss-service.xml: <!-- EJB deployer, remove to disable EJB behavior--> <mbean code="org.jboss.ejb.EJBDeployer" name="jboss.ejb:service=EJBDeployer"> <attribute name="VerifyDeployments">true</attribute> <attribute name="ValidateDTDs">false</attribute> <attribute name="MetricsEnabled">false</attribute> <attribute name="VerifierVerbose">true</attribute> <!-- StrictVerifier: Setting this to 'true' will cause all deployments to fail when the Verifier detected a problem with the contained Beans. --> <attribute name="StrictVerifier">false</attribute> [...] -- Bancotec GmbH EMail: hei...@ba...
